Overview

Zhipeng Cai is affiliated with Georgia State University in the United States and has contributed extensively to the field of computer science, with a focus on artificial intelligence, computer networks, and security-related topics. Their research output spans a variety of interdisciplinary subfields with relevance to both theoretical and applied aspects of computing.

The scientist's publication record includes works across multiple well-known venues. Frequent publication outlets include arXiv (Cornell University), IEEE Internet of Things Journal, IEEE Transactions on Mobile Computing, IEEE Transactions on Computational Social Systems, and the Journal of Computational Biology.

Zhipeng Cai has also contributed to academic book publications through Springer Science+Business Media, with titles such as "Bioinformatics Research and Applications" published in 2021 and 2022.

Professional recognition includes being named an ACM Senior Member in 2020.
